实验性肝转移瘤的血供。VII. 关于肾上腺素引起肿瘤血管增多的进一步研究。

The blood supply of experimental liver metastases. VII. Further studies on increased tumor vascularity caused by epinephrine.

作者信息

Ackerman N B, Makohon S

出版信息

Microcirc Endothelium Lymphatics. 1984 Oct;1(5):547-68.

PMID:6546157
Abstract

The effects of epinephrine on the vascularity of tumors within the liver of rats were studied by simultaneous injection of Microfil into the arterial and portal systems. A marked increase in perfusion of capillary-sized vessels within the central portions of the tumor was observed in both induced hepatomas and implanted Walker carcinosarcoma tumors. In studies with implanted tumors, the effect of epinephrine on enhancing vascularity internally was eliminated by the alpha adrenergic block agent phenoxybenzamine, but was not affected by the beta adrenergic blocking agent propranolol.

摘要

通过同时将微丝(Microfil)注入动脉和门静脉系统,研究了肾上腺素对大鼠肝脏内肿瘤血管分布的影响。在诱导性肝癌和植入性沃克癌肉瘤肿瘤中,均观察到肿瘤中央部分毛细血管大小血管的灌注显著增加。在植入性肿瘤的研究中,肾上腺素增强内部血管分布的作用可被α肾上腺素能阻滞剂酚苄明消除,但不受β肾上腺素能阻滞剂普萘洛尔的影响。
